Simpson, St Thomas the Apostle

Tower:  
Bell:

Diameter: 27½"Cast by: Taylor in 1895
2Documented weight: 4 - 2 - 24 (Dove)
Nominal: Flat of E by 31 cents (based on analysis by Wavanal)Documented note: E (Dove)

Inscriptions

Process Inscription

 
 

WILLIAM RICE, RECTOR C. W. WODHAMS, CHURCHWARDENS

 
 

THIS NEW TREBLE BELL COMPLETING THE RING OF FIVE WAS ADDED IN 1895 WHEN THE OTHER FOUR WERE TUNED AND REHUNG

Analysis of partial tones based on analysis by Wavanal:

Actual tuning of partialsVariation from Simpson tuning
Hum: 327Hz, which is Flat of E by 3 cents                     Should be: 322 Hz
Prime: 600Hz, which is Sharp of D by 13 cents                     Should be: 644 Hz
Tierce: 766Hz, which is Flat of G by 18 cents                     Should be: 759 Hz
Quint: 982Hz, which is Flat of B by 6 cents                     Should be: 966 Hz
Nominal: 1288Hz, which is Flat of E by 31 cents                     Should be: 1288 Hz
Upper Third: 1546Hz, which is Flat of G by 22 cents                     Should be: 1622 Hz
Upper Quint: 1916Hz, which is Sharp of A#/Bb by 51 cents                     Should be: 1919 Hz
Upper Octave: 2621Hz, which is Flat of E by 16 cents                     Should be: 2563 Hz
